Clippers’ Struggles highlight a Costly Trade as Stars Face a Tight Timeline
The Los Angeles Clippers find themselves in a precarious position. Despite the Herculean efforts of James Harden, averaging an extraordinary 33.1 points, 6.7 rebounds, and 7.8 assists over his last nine games with a 45.5% field goal percentage and 37.3% from three-point range, the team has only managed to secure two wins during that stretch. this disconnect between individual brilliance and team success is raising serious concerns as the season progresses.
Kawhi Leonard‘s impending return offers a glimmer of hope, but the recent season-ending injury to Bradley beal substantially narrows the window for the Clippers to contend. Time is quickly running out to salvage a successful season.
The Powell Regret: A Trade that May Haunt the Clippers
One potential solution, ironically, might have been traded away.The Clippers could certainly benefit from a player like Norman Powell right now. They sent Powell to the Miami Heat in the summer to acquire John Collins, a move that is increasingly looking like a misstep.
Collins hasn’t been a detriment to the team, but his impact hasn’t justified the loss of Powell’s consistent scoring and efficiency.
Norman Powell’s Impact in Miami:
* He’s currently enjoying an extraordinary season with the heat.
* Powell has scored 19 or more points in 13 of his 15 games.
* His shooting splits are remarkable: 49.4% from the field, 44.1% from three-point range, and 88.4% from the free-throw line.
this level of performance has even sparked All-Star consideration for the 32-year-old. Now playing in the Eastern Conference, Powell has a clearer path to achieving his long-held dream of becoming an NBA All-star if he maintains this trajectory.
